“Undercover stings encourage ‘law enforcement’ agents to behave like criminals. One example is the ATF’s operations in several cities, where agents set up phony storefront businesses such as pawn shops. The Milwaukee Journal-Sentinal reports (http://bit.ly/1boPIij) some of the crimes they got away with… Knowingly purchased stolen property, prompting more burglaries in their neighborhoods; Damaged the buildings they rented, then abandoned them without compensating the landlords; Allowed minors to drink and smoke pot on their premises.
